    Cobalt 60 has a half life of 5.27 years.

    If the 7-1-63 is a date stamp of original manufacture, it’s gone through over 11 half-lives. There’s less than .05% of the original flavour.

    I don’t know about the decay products, but I’d wonder how far we are from legitimately edible.
